Contractors - Computer in MIT, Cambridge

238 Main St, Cambridge, Massachusetts, 02142-1016

(617) 576-3450


219 Vassar St, Cambridge, Massachusetts, 02139-4310

(508) 598-6000


1 Memorial Dr, Ste 1, Cambridge, Massachusetts, 02142-1346

(617) 494-0167


8 Cambridge Ctr, Cambridge, Massachusetts, 02142-1413

(617) 444-3000


5 Cambridge Ctr, Cambridge, Massachusetts, 02142-1407

(617) 528-7500


4 Cambridge Ctr, Cambridge, Massachusetts, 02142-1406

(617) 494-4814